Emmy wins lead to piracy surge
September 3, 2014
By Colin Mann
According to findings from CEG TEK International, a provider of in-depth business intelligence and comprehensive anti-piracy solutions, piracy rates for five Emmy-winning shows surged over 340 per cent within a day of the broadcast.
